What type of bearing is most generally used as an independent main thrust block on merchant ships?

Official USCG Answer & Rule Citation

Correct Answer: Option D — Pivoted-shoe thrust bearing.

Pivoted-shoe thrust bearings, such as the Kingsbury design, are the industry standard for merchant ships. They utilize tilting pads that form a wedge-shaped oil film, allowing the bearing to support extremely high axial loads while maintaining low friction and preventing metal-to-metal contact during operation.
